Output 603031043b0a168dba56257c73e59e5056894b4cb1dca4da28daf052fe6d0f6f:0

value
1961852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ba1331eee4f86dad2488098910b6224705ce1a6 OP_EQUAL
address
3LFiCqTDRKjdVjzGeKcTBXY7Mu9yzdYg6V
transaction
603031043b0a168dba56257c73e59e5056894b4cb1dca4da28daf052fe6d0f6f
spent
true